Transaction ddc31caeb40f6f177d169d0e58260cd616dc7a4aa1d61319f55bbeba3002c725
1 Input
1 Output
-
ddc31caeb40f6f177d169d0e58260cd616dc7a4aa1d61319f55bbeba3002c725: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5d2a360ac4396fcc9376968b4d08ce87a92f651199495bd4b3efdcfcddffe685
- address
- bc1pt54rvzky89hueymkj6956zxws75j7eg3n9y4h49nalw0eh0lu6zsxl5ak2